Output ab6aefff98cbcce8ec9ae07c25c1a7964d4bbb73016ae7a499222a2f89a29ee5:2

value
1383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63ff31237a69ac22afdc4b80b30ec0cb67e1a57 OP_EQUAL
address
3Q94m2HWXBormeBsS9t3rXkx11NeDXQq84
transaction
ab6aefff98cbcce8ec9ae07c25c1a7964d4bbb73016ae7a499222a2f89a29ee5
confirmations
33038
spent
true